Round, Screened and Unscreened, 60 V and 600 V Multi-Core Sheathed Cables

2012-09-07
CURRENT
J2501_201209
This standard specifies basic and high performance test methods and requirements for round, screened and unscreened, multi-core sheathed cables intended for use in road vehicle applications. The unscreened, single-core cables shall be in accordance with ISO 6722, SAE J1127, SAE J1128, SAE J1654, SAE J1678, or SAE J2183. Other cores may be used, but in these cases, the construction and tests required to ensure functionality of these cores shall be agreed between customer and supplier. See ISO 6722 for temperature classes. ISO 6722 will be needed to perform some of the tests in this standard.

Standard

Un-shielded Balanced Single Twisted Pair Ethernet Cable

2017-05-26
HISTORICAL
J3117_201705
This document covers un-shielded balanced single twisted pair data cable intended for use in surface vehicle cables for 100 Mbps Ethernet applications. The tests in this document are intended to qualify cables for normal operation in an automotive environment while maintaining the necessary electrical properties for reliable data transmission.

Standard

60 V and 600 V Single-Core Cables

2012-09-07
CURRENT
J2183_201209
This Standard specifies the test methods, dimensions, and requirements for single-core 60 V cables intended for use in road vehicle applications where the nominal system voltage ≤ 60 V DC (25 V AC). It also specifies additional test methods and/or requirements for 600 V cables intended for use in road vehicle applications where the nominal system voltage is > 60 V DC (25 V AC) to ≤ 600 V DC (600 V AC). Where practical, this standard uses ISO 6722 for test methods, dimensions, and requirements. This standard covers ISO conductor sizes which usually differ from SAE conductor sizes. It also covers the individual cores in multi-core cables. See ISO 6722 for “Temperature Class Ratings”.

Standard

Fusible Links

2022-07-19
CURRENT
J156_202207
This standard covers supplemental requirements for low tension primary cable intended for use as Fusible Links (Fuse Links) at a nominal system voltage of 60 V DC (25 V AC) or less in surface vehicle electrical systems. These supplemental requirements are intended to qualify cables for an extreme current overload.
